Heritage Park

Address19200 Collins Avenue

Hours

  • Daily (except Fridays), 8 am – 9 pm
  • Fridays, 12 pm – 9 pm

Description

4 acres of park and play space including two playgrounds, Veteran’s Wall, fountains, water play area, stage, dog park, large open lawn and public parking.

Dog Zone

The leash-free dog area is located at the south side of the park.

Nominate a Veteran

The Veteran’s Wall at Heritage Park displays the names of Sunny Isles Beach residents that have served our country in the military. Every year new names of Sunny Isles Beach residents who have served in the United States Military are added to the wall.

*Nomination applications are available online or at the Government Center at 18070 Collins Avenue. Please bring proof of honorable discharge from military service and proof of residency in the City of Sunny Isles Beach. Your SIB Resident ID can be used as proof of residency or a utility bill with the veteran’s name.
